Shanghai Film Co Ltd (601595) has an Asset Resilience Ratio of 3.87% as of March 2026. The Asset Resilience Ratio measures the percentage of a company's total assets that are held in liquid form (cash and short-term investments). This metric indicates how well-positioned the company is to handle unexpected financial challenges, economic downturns, or strategic opportunities without requiring external financing.

About

Shanghai Film Co., Ltd. engages in film distribution and screening activities in China. It is involved in the operation and sale of copyrights; and provision of online ticketing and membership services, as well as investment, development, and operation of cinemas and cultural facilities.
